Predictive Logic Analysis

The absence of any renewal announcement eight months after the season finale is the most telling signal here. YAIBA aired 24 episodes from April through September 2025 and has since gone quiet on the announcement front. TMDB lists it as a returning series, but that metadata alone is not a reliable renewal confirmation, especially for international anime where production cycles and announcements can lag significantly behind a season's air date. Without explicit coverage from industry sources or the network, there's no basis for confidence either way.

The show's audience metrics suggest modest but stable interest. Trakt active watchers sit at 1403 with steady momentum, which is neither a breakout signal nor a red flag. The episode-rating trajectory is more concerning: a fall from the season's opening through its finale suggests viewer engagement declined as the season progressed, even if the absolute average of 8.5/10 is respectable. This pattern typically reflects one of two outcomes: either the show lost steam and viewers tuned out, or the tail-end episodes had smaller or more critical voting samples. Either way, it's not a tailwind for renewal.

Nippon TV is a major Japanese broadcaster that does greenlight sequels to original anime, but their renewal timelines and decision windows are often opaque to Western industry coverage. A full eight-month silence is not unusual for anime greenlit for a second season, nor is it a guarantee. The show is old enough now that if it were renewed, some announcement would likely have surfaced by now, but the absence cannot yet be read as formal cancellation either.

What is YAIBA: Samurai Legend about?

YAIBA: Samurai Legend is a vibrant action-adventure that breathes fresh energy into the samurai coming-of-age narrative by transplanting its protagonist into the collision of tradition and modernity. Yaiba Kurogane begins as an unpolished swordsman raised in isolation, thrust into a sprawling urban landscape where he must navigate complex hierarchies of rivals and allies while uncovering the ancient supernatural forces that lurk beneath the city's contemporary surface. The show's central appeal lies in this fundamental fish-out-of-water tension: Yaiba's raw determination and straightforward honor clash against a world far more layered and morally ambiguous than his forest home prepared him for, creating genuine stakes in his quest for mastery.

The series distinguishes itself through a tonal balancing act that blends kinetic action sequences with genuine comedy and moments of introspection. Rather than treating its fantasy elements as mere window dressing, YAIBA weaves ancient powers organically into both its world-building and character motivations, allowing sci-fi and fantasy sensibilities to coexist naturally within a samurai framework. The animation captures both intimate character moments and explosive combat with equal care, while the chemistry between Yaiba and Sayaka Mine provides emotional grounding alongside the spectacle.

YAIBA: Samurai Legend Season 2 Release Date

If a second season is greenlit, a late 2025 or 2026 announcement would not be surprising, with a possible 2026 air date. However, at eight months post-finale with zero renewal signal, any production timeline is purely speculative. Japanese anime production typically requires 18 to 24 months lead time from greenlight to broadcast, so even a renewal announced today would likely air no earlier than mid-to-late 2026. Given the silence, it is equally plausible that no second season is in development.
